Today
Crook County School Board — The school board is expected to meet at 6:30 p.m. at the district’s administration office, 471 N.E. Ochoco Plaza Drive in Prineville. The board is scheduled to receive an update on remodeling projects currently underway in the schools, as well as the design for a new elementary school.
Tuesday
Redmond City Council — In their weekly 6:30 p.m. meeting at Redmond City Hall at 777 S.W. Deschutes Ave., councilors are expected to host a public hearing to consider the sale and relocation of the old Redmond Schoolhouse. The schoolhouse, currently in the Dry Canyon and owned by the city, has long been vacant. The city is seeking proposals for its sale and relocation, and thus far has received three.
Bend-La Pine Schools — At its 6 p.m. meeting at the district’s education center at 520 N.W. Wall St. in Bend, the school board is expected to hear presentations on a recently received grant for career technical education programs, as well as from the High Desert Education Service District on its local service plan.
